Output 3618d91bcd261304150d35ebd0ee644112a9dfe2f46de3a0757e358875138530:0

value
1005118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fdedaee6386a0f25edc065cf7cb23ae7f153dc6 OP_EQUAL
address
3BtXu63E6PbQiUQ5nsXQZdmVtnS2tGdsoc
transaction
3618d91bcd261304150d35ebd0ee644112a9dfe2f46de3a0757e358875138530
spent
true